IICONIC footwear is created through a circular design approach. Tackling the main polluting production phases of footwear, such as material extraction of resources and shoe manufacturing. The solution: 3D printed footwear customized to your feet’s shape and recyclable into new shoes. After a shoe has lived its life, the socks yarn and shoe sole are recycled into new yarns and filament. This allows you to always stay on trend and personalize your shoes with the colors and design of your choosing

4D textiles can be created from 3D printing on stretched out textiles. This can result in shape changing fabrics that could possibly be used as interfaces for wearables and interiors. By researching the expressivity and interaction of 11 different shape changing textiles with experts in the field, I hope to create a toolkit for textile designers. Consequently, making it easier for desingers to incorporate shape changing interfaces in their work.
MIS is a suit that explores the boundaries of wearable design. Looking at ways to create circular fabric, the suit explores what daily wear on Mars could look like. This resulted into a suit made from glass, 3D printed from Martian sand into different structures to show what you can do with limited resources. By using different 3D printing techniques, multiple ways of printing fabric have been explored.
LAXX is a rubber material created through SLS 3D printing. The material responds to environmental sound by either visualizing a tense or relaxed state. LAXX therefore offers the user an interface that creates an interaction with their environment.
